The Role of Gambling Licenses
Gambling licenses serve as a regulatory framework that ensures the integrity and fairness of gaming operations. By obtaining a license, casinos and online gaming platforms demonstrate their commitment to adhering to local laws and international standards. This process helps protect players from fraud and unethical practices, fostering a safer gaming environment. The licensing authority evaluates the applicant’s financial stability, operational transparency, and adherence to responsible gambling policies before granting approval.
Moreover, the existence of a gambling license boosts consumer confidence. Players are more inclined to engage with licensed operators, knowing that their funds are secure and that they are participating in fair games. This trust plays a significant role in the success of gaming establishments, as a positive reputation can lead to increased customer retention and attracting new players. Consequently, the licensing process is crucial for both new and established businesses in the gambling sector.
Types of Gambling Licenses
Different jurisdictions offer various types of gambling licenses, each with unique requirements and benefits. For instance, online casinos may acquire licenses from regions like Malta, Gibraltar, or the United Kingdom, each known for stringent regulations. These licenses vary in terms of compliance standards, tax rates, and operational flexibility. Operators often choose a specific licensing jurisdiction based on their business strategy, target market, and the regulatory advantages offered.
Land-based casinos typically require licenses from local or state authorities, which often involve thorough vetting processes. These licenses not only impose operational guidelines but also dictate the types of gambling allowed within the establishment. Understanding the implications of these different licensing options is crucial for businesses looking to navigate the competitive gambling landscape effectively.
The Economic Impact of Licensing
The economic benefits of gambling licenses extend beyond the operators themselves. Licensed casinos contribute significantly to local economies through job creation and tax revenues. This influx of funds can be vital for community development, funding public services, and enhancing infrastructure. In many cases, regions that embrace regulated gambling experience a boost in tourism as well, attracting visitors eager to experience the entertainment offerings.
Additionally, a regulated gambling industry can deter illegal operations, which often undermine legitimate businesses and local economies. By ensuring that licensed entities abide by laws and regulations, authorities can promote healthy competition, protect consumers, and ultimately create a more stable economic environment. The ripple effect of this stability is felt across various sectors, highlighting the importance of effective gambling regulation.
Challenges in Licensing
While gambling licenses are essential, the licensing process can present numerous challenges for operators. The application process is often lengthy and requires extensive documentation and financial disclosures. This level of scrutiny can be daunting for new entrants, particularly those without established reputations. In some cases, operators may face obstacles related to compliance with evolving regulations, which can necessitate significant operational adjustments.
Furthermore, ongoing compliance with licensing requirements can strain resources, especially for smaller businesses. Continuous monitoring and reporting are often required to maintain a license, adding to operational costs. Navigating these challenges requires strategic planning and a commitment to maintaining high standards of operation to ensure long-term success in the gambling industry.
